    Manager, Communications and Marketing

    Reports to: Vice President, Advancement and Membership

    Status: Full-time, exempt

    Team: Advancement

    Salary Range: $72,000–$80,000

    Overview

    The Manager, Communications and Marketing oversees the New York Genealogical and Biographical Society's (NYG&B) day-to-day external communications, including email marketing, the biweekly eNews, website content, and social media.

    Specific Responsibilities

    • Email Marketing: Plan and execute email marketing campaigns to support membership, programs, and fundraising goals.
    • eNews: Produce and distribute the biweekly eNews, coordinating content from across the organization.
    • Website: Maintain and update website content, ensuring accuracy and alignment with current programming and campaigns.
    • Social Media: Manage a modern, engaged presence across Facebook, Instagram, TikTok, YouTube, and LinkedIn — incorporating video and current trends to grow base audience.
    • Measurement: Track performance across email, eNews, website, and social channels; report results to inform strategy.
    • Cross-Team Collaboration: Work with the Programs Manager and Grants Contractor to source content from events, programs, and existing video assets.
    • Strategic Plan Alignment: Execute communications tasks tied to the four strategic plans (Digitize New York, New Netherland Settlers, Scholar in Residence, Advancement) as directed by the Vice President, Advancement and Membership.

    Qualifications

    • 2–4 years of marketing/communications experience, nonprofit preferred
    • Proficiency with email marketing platforms and social media management/scheduling tools
    • Hands-on experience creating and posting video and visual content (short-form video for TikTok/Instagram Reels/YouTube Shorts, graphics, photo editing) — not just scheduling, but producing the content itself
    • Demonstrated social media engagement skills — responding to comments/messages, building community, identifying trends, and adapting content to platform-specific audiences
    • Strong writing skills; comfort with basic website CMS editing
    • Basic video editing software proficiency (e.g., CapCut, Adobe Premiere/Rush, Canva Video)
    • Interest in genealogy, history, or archives helpful but not required
